Pricing
Caddick Construction Ltd
Contact
No bio yet
Location
England, United Kingdom
Links
Neil Lindley
Contract Manager
10 people, 0 jobs
This person is not in any offices
Commonwealth Fusion Systems
Innovaderm Research Inc.
LUKOIL
Kilnbridge
OMNIA Partners
View more